Facts and Interesting Points About UNESCO

The United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O) is at the forefront of global efforts to foster peace and sustainable development through international collaboration in education, science, culture, and communication. Established in 1945, UNESCO works tirelessly to protect cultural heritage, promote scientific research, and ensure access to quality education for all.
